Reset the connection between your authenticator app and Weel if you've lost access to the device it's on, as part of two-factor authentication.
Before you start
- You'll still need to be able to sign in and pass verification with your other 2FA method (SMS). If you've lost access to both your phone number and your authenticator app, this article won't help. See How to sign into Weel if you get locked out without a 2FA device instead.
- This assumes you already have an authenticator app connected. If you haven't set one up yet, you'll see an Add authenticator app button instead. See How to add an authenticator app as a verification method.
Steps
Web app
- Open the Weel web app and log in.
- Click the Settings cog in the top right corner.
- Click Settings.
- On the Profile screen, find the Two-step authentication panel.
- Next to Authenticator app, click Reset.
- Scan the QR code with your authenticator app, or click Use setup key and copy the setup key into your authenticator app instead.
- Enter the 6-digit code from your authenticator app into the pop-up.
- Click Submit.
Mobile app
- Open the Weel mobile app.
- Tap Menu in the top left corner.
- Select Security.
- Select Two-step authentication.
- Log in when the in-app browser opens to your Settings page, pre-filled with your email.
- Tap Reset next to Authenticator app on the Profile screen.
- Scan the QR code with your authenticator app, or tap Use setup key and copy the setup key into your authenticator app instead.
- Enter the 6-digit code from your authenticator app into the pop-up.
- Tap Submit.
What happens next
You'll authenticate with your newly connected authenticator app going forward. Your previous authenticator entry no longer works.
